If we call the width w, then the length is w+3. We know that the perimeter is the sum of all 4 sides, that is two widths and two heights. That give the following equation:

2w+2(w+3)=30

Then solve for w. Remember, what you do to one side, you must do to the other so it continues to have equal sides of the equation.

2w+2w+6=30
4w+6=30
4w+6-6=30-6
4w+0=24
4w=24
1/4*4w=24*1/4
1*w=6
w=6

If the width=6 meters, the length must be w+3 or 9 meters. Check to see if the perimeter is 30 meters.
